Histoire administrative
According to newspaper articles, the Moose Jaw Horticultural Society existed as far back as 1922, but there is no information available documenting when the Society was formed and by who. They are affiliated with the Saskatchewan Horticultural Society and the Division of Extension and Community Relations Division of the University of Saskatchewan.
The Society held regular meetings, including educational meetings when presenters spoke on topics of horticulture. Every year a “green thumb” sale as held for the public to purchase bedding out plants, houseplants and perennials. Members attended provincial horticultural shows and conventions. Annually, the Moose Jaw Horticultural Society had perennial competitions, yard and garden competitions, a garden tea, and a fall fair and banquet, with local businesses, groups or individuals sponsoring prizes. The Moose Jaw Horticultural Society disbanded in 2005. Remaining funds were donated to the Moose Jaw Public Library.

Portée et contenu
This fonds consists of three series. There are records of the Moose Jaw Horticultural Society of the late 1980's and 1990's. There are membership and directors lists, minutes of meetings, financial statements and correspondence. There are schedules, information and publicity on events held by the society. There are 2 scrapbooks from 1990 and 1991 that contain photos, programs, memorabilia and newspaper clippings. There are also loose newspapers clippings and some which have been glued on loose leaf pages and a notebook. There are minutes and newsletters from the Saskatchewan Horticultural Association as well as reports, brochures and publication information from the Extension and Community Relations Division of the University of Saskatchewan. There is one copy of the periodical “The Saskatchewan Gardener”, Winter 1995 edition.
